Magnetic photo display frame

Description

FIG. 1 is a diagrammatic perspective of a magnetic photo display frame in full lines with a refrigerator shown in broken lines representing environmental association matter being for illustrative purposes only and forming no part of the claimed invention.

FIG. 2 is a diagrammatic perspective view of the magnetic photo display frame with a top layer bent upward in full lines with photos and a mounting surface as in therebelow as in FIG. 1 shown in broken lines representing environmental association matter being for illustrative purposes only and forming no part of the claimed invention.

FIG. 3 is a top plan view of the magnetic photo display frame.

FIG. 4 is a bottom plan view thereof.

FIG. 5 is a front elevational view thereof, the rear elevational view being a mirror image of the front view; and,

FIG. 6 is a left side elevational view thereof, the right side elevational view being a mirror image of the left side view.
